Don't reduce forest land without giving compensatory land: Supreme Court to Centre, States

The direction was passed while hearing a batch of petitions challenging the constitutional validity of the Forest Conservation Amendment Act of 2023.

In an order of significant import, the Supreme Court on February 3 directed that the Central government or States shall not do anything which will lead to reduction of forest land unless compensatory land is provided either by the State or the Union of India for the purpose of afforestation [Ashok Kumar Sharma, Indian Forest Service (Retd) & Ors. Vs Union Of India & Anr].
